Chemical & Physical Properties

Density1.4±0.1 g/cm3
Boiling Point157.6±0.0 °C at 760 mmHg
Melting Point38-41 °C(lit.)
Molecular FormulaC6H4F2O
Molecular Weight130.092
Flash Point58.9±0.0 °C
Exact Mass130.023026
PSA20.23000
LogP1.98
Vapour Pressure2.1±0.3 mmHg at 25°C
Index of Refraction1.496
InChIKeyCKKOVFGIBXCEIJ-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ILESOc1c(F)cccc1F
Storage condition2-8°C
